Major duties

Under the supervision of the Sponsorship/Marketing Manager, Marine Corps Marathon Organization (MCMO) aids in marketing and sponsorship management for the MCMO. Incumbent assists the Sponsorship/Marketing Manager and other MCM Branch heads in the performance of marketing, MCMO partnership program coordination, sponsorship and advertisement. Researches, conducts cold calls and sponsorship outreach, and coordinates marketing and sponsorship activities for MCMO and its events. Assists in planning marketing strategies and placement of in-kind goods and services to support MCMO and its events. Assists Marketing/Sponsorship Manager with sponsor recruitment, writing sponsorship contracts and monitors timelines and fulfillment. Assists in the development of various marketing materials and edits as needed such as runner brochures, applications, and other MCMO related material, Coordinates layout and distribution of newsletters, coordinates logo placement, sponsorship recognition and sponsorship online surveys using government approved software. Coordinates MCMO in-kind sponsorship and marketing products. Edits and executes social media outlets for MCMO and its events to include posting photos/videos and status updates and direct messaging. Conducts website editing and website development. Assists in communication and promotional requirements including developing brochures, promotional campaigns and posters, utilizing artwork and text. Manages marketing calendar and advertising plan. Monitors competitor online presence. Coordinates Finish Festival, and vendor area and assists with Expo during the MCM and Marine Corps Historic Half, to include layout and placement, food and vendor licenses for vendors, and sponsor fulfillment during race day.Reviews all outgoing sponsorship agreements to include grammar, format, and compliance with administrative policy. Initiates and prepares routine correspondence including letters, sponsorship and partnership agreements, memoranda, and messages using various software. Responds to routine telephone inquiries and routine mail. Maintains official files and periodically disposes of records in accordance with official disposition instructions. Assists with the coordination of MCM publicity through newsletters, newspapers, brochures, posters, and other media sources. Assists branch head and staff members by performing various marketing, clerical, and administrative tasks.May be required to travel to attend MCMO races, meetings and expos to promote races and events by attending other race expos to set up booths with MCMO race materials to promote MCMO race series by handing out MCMO materials, speaking to runners about MCMO races and events, and soliciting vendors to participate in races. Prepares for MCMO races and events by setting up cones, tents, start and finish lines and other race requirements. Observation of race practices by attending other races within the running industry and learning how they prepare, plan and execute races and upon return implement race practices and procedures at MCMO races. May be required to stand for extended periods of times at expos handing out materials and speaking with runners and vendors about MCMO races. Adheres to safety regulations and standards. Uses required safety equipment and observes safe work procedures. Promptly reports any observed workplace hazards, and any injury, occupational illness, and/or property damage resulting from workplace mishaps to the immediate supervisor.Performs other related duties as assigned.

Requirements

EVALUATIONS:

Qualification

Three years of experience that demonstrates work experience in marketing. Strong computer skills, strong writing, oral communication, negotiation and sales skills are a must. This is a white-collar position where occasional lifting up to 20 lbs may be required. An equivalent combination of training and experience may be substituted for the qualifications above. Must possess valid driver¿s license.
